Chip Schottky Barrier Diodes FM320-AN THRU FM3100-AN Silicon epitaxial planer type Formosa MS SMA-N 0.185(4.8) 0.173(4.4) 0.012(0.3) Typ. Features Plastic package has Underwriters Laboratory Flammability Classification 94V-O Utilizing Flame Retardant Epoxy Molding Compound. For surface mounted applications.
